问题标签 [mongoosastic]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
node.js - 删除文档后未删除 mongoosastic 索引数据
目前我正在使用猫鼬 Model.remove 方法来删除文档。但是在删除文档 mongoosastic 索引后仍然包含已删除的文档索引。
node.js - 如何使用弹性搜索 2.2.0 初始化 mongoosastic
我在我的 node.js 服务器中设置 mongoosastic 时遇到了麻烦。我跟着视频讲座,但它不起作用。
但是,有人说如果我降级弹性搜索版本,就可以了。但我认为它也应该能够与 elasticsearch v2.2 一起使用。
这是点亮的代码。
这是错误。
谢谢你的帮助!
mongoose - 保存到猫鼬后立即进行猫鼬搜索
我有一个用于将数据发布到猫鼬的 api 端点。我尝试在之后立即执行搜索,我得到 0 个结果。编码:
我的点击返回空。如果我用1000 毫秒Schema.search
的超时时间包围,我会得到我希望的结果。
我不想使用这个超时解决方法。有人有建议吗?谢谢。
elasticsearch - 将 KeystoneJS 中的 Type.Relationship 值索引到弹性搜索中
我是 KeystoneJs 的新手,我想Type.Relationship
使用 mongoosastic 在弹性搜索中索引 a。问题在于 Mongo 数据Type.Relationship
存储为 ObjectID 数组 - 而不是实际关系的值 - 因为每个可能有多个(categories
参见platform
下文
这些ObjectId
s 的platform
格式为:
谁能把我放在正确的路径上以添加到name
引用的 ObjectIds 的弹性搜索索引中?
node.js - mongoosastic 4.x 和 elasticsearch 2.2 的建议完成问题
我正在尝试使用 mongoosastic 进行自动完成,我有以下代码:
在映射期间,我收到此错误消息
[illegal_argument_exception] 映射器 [label] 无法从类型 [string] 更改为 [completion]]
当我进行搜索时,出现以下错误
[class_cast_exception] org.elasticsearch.index.mapper.core.StringFieldMapper$StringFieldType 不能转换为 org.elasticsearch.index.mapper.core.CompletionFieldMapper$CompletionFieldType
elasticsearch - mongoosastic 在 elasticsearch 的建议器中传递有效负载
如果可能的话,如何通过 mongoosastic 在完成建议器(elasticsearch)中索引文档时传递有效负载?我在 mongoosastic 中找不到任何文档。
node.js - 如何对elasticsearch中的多个字段进行模糊查询?
这是我的查询:
这是 Node.js 中回调的一部分。 Query
(作为比较值插入)在函数的前面设置。
我需要它能够做的是模糊地检查文档的 theauthor
和 the career_title
,并返回在任一字段中匹配的任何文档。上面的语句从不返回任何东西,每当我尝试访问它应该创建的对象时,它都会说它是未定义的。我知道我可以编写两个查询,一个来检查每个字段,然后按分数对结果进行排序,但我觉得为一个字段搜索每个对象两次会比为两个字段搜索每个对象一次要慢。
mongodb - 批量索引对我不起作用 - mongoosastic
无论批次大小或延迟大小如何,仅对 1 个批次进行索引。
即使 mongodb 中有超过 10 条记录,索引也只有 10。
错误:
[MongoError:光标被杀死或超时] 名称:'MongoError',消息:'光标被杀死或超时'。
elasticsearch - Mongoosastic,我如何进行地理距离查询
对于猫鼬,我的架构看起来像这样:
我添加了一个新文档:
现在我想按距离过滤。我的查询如下所示:
但我总是得到错误
我的问题是:如何按距离正确过滤?
elasticsearch - 在 Keystonejs 中使用 Mongoosastic 索引现有集合时遇到问题
我让 Mongoosastic 在 Keystone 中研究了一些模型,它们使用以下方法更新得很好:
但是,当我尝试同步/索引现有集合(https://github.com/mongoosastic/mongoosastic#indexing-mongoose-references)以提取所有先前条目的记录方式时:
我收到一个错误:
显然,这是行不通的,所以我尝试用mongoose.model
...keystone.list
替换
但后来我得到了挥霍:
完成了:
似乎应该很简单......有人知道我错过了什么吗?请。任何帮助是极大的赞赏!粉丝。